1 /* -*- Mode: C++;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- */
3 * This file is part of the LibreOffice project.
5 * This Source Code Form is subject to the terms of the Mozilla Public
6 * License, v. 2.0. If a copy of the MPL was not distributed with this
7 * file, You can obtain one at http://mozilla.org/MPL/2.0/.
9 * This file incorporates work covered by the following license notice:
11 * Licensed to the Apache Software Foundation (ASF) under one or more
12 * contributor license agreements. See the NOTICE file distributed
13 * with this work for additional information regarding copyright
14 * ownership. The ASF licenses this file to you under the Apache
15 * License, Version 2.0 (the "License"); you may not use this file
16 * except in compliance with the License. You may obtain a copy of
17 * the License at http://www.apache.org/licenses/LICENSE-2.0 .
20 module ooo
{ module vba
{ module office
{
21 constants MsoAutoShapeType
{
22 const long msoShape16pointStar
= 94;
23 const long msoShape24pointStar
= 95;
24 const long msoShape32pointStar
= 96;
25 const long msoShape4pointStar
= 91;
26 const long msoShape5pointStar
= 92;
27 const long msoShape8pointStar
= 93;
28 const long msoShapeActionButtonBackorPrevious
= 129;
29 const long msoShapeActionButtonBeginning
= 131;
30 const long msoShapeActionButtonCustom
= 125;
31 const long msoShapeActionButtonDocument
= 134;
32 const long msoShapeActionButtonEnd
= 132;
33 const long msoShapeActionButtonForwardorNext
= 130;
34 const long msoShapeActionButtonHelp
= 127;
35 const long msoShapeActionButtonHome
= 126;
36 const long msoShapeActionButtonInformation
= 128;
37 const long msoShapeActionButtonMovie
= 136;
38 const long msoShapeActionButtonReturn
= 133;
39 const long msoShapeActionButtonSound
= 135;
40 const long msoShapeArc
= 25;
41 const long msoShapeBalloon
= 137;
42 const long msoShapeBentArrow
= 41;
43 const long msoShapeBentUpArrow
= 44;
44 const long msoShapeBevel
= 15;
45 const long msoShapeBlockArc
= 20;
46 const long msoShapeCan
= 13;
47 const long msoShapeChevron
= 52;
48 const long msoShapeCircularArrow
= 60;
49 const long msoShapeCloudCallout
= 108;
50 const long msoShapeCross
= 11;
51 const long msoShapeCube
= 14;
52 const long msoShapeCurvedDownArrow
= 48;
53 const long msoShapeCurvedDownRibbon
= 100;
54 const long msoShapeCurvedLeftArrow
= 46;
55 const long msoShapeCurvedRightArrow
= 45;
56 const long msoShapeCurvedUpArrow
= 47;
57 const long msoShapeCurvedUpRibbon
= 99;
58 const long msoShapeDiamond
= 4;
59 const long msoShapeDonut
= 18;
60 const long msoShapeDoubleBrace
= 27;
61 const long msoShapeDoubleBracket
= 26;
62 const long msoShapeDoubleWave
= 104;
63 const long msoShapeDownArrow
= 36;
64 const long msoShapeDownArrowCallout
= 56;
65 const long msoShapeDownRibbon
= 98;
66 const long msoShapeExplosion1
= 89;
67 const long msoShapeExplosion2
= 90;
68 const long msoShapeFlowchartAlternateProcess
= 62;
69 const long msoShapeFlowchartCard
= 75;
70 const long msoShapeFlowchartCollate
= 79;
71 const long msoShapeFlowchartConnector
= 73;
72 const long msoShapeFlowchartData
= 64;
73 const long msoShapeFlowchartDecision
= 63;
74 const long msoShapeFlowchartDelay
= 84;
75 const long msoShapeFlowchartDirectAccessStorage
= 87;
76 const long msoShapeFlowchartDisplay
= 88;
77 const long msoShapeFlowchartDocument
= 67;
78 const long msoShapeFlowchartExtract
= 81;
79 const long msoShapeFlowchartInternalStorage
= 66;
80 const long msoShapeFlowchartMagneticDisk
= 86;
81 const long msoShapeFlowchartManualInput
= 71;
82 const long msoShapeFlowchartManualOperation
= 72;
83 const long msoShapeFlowchartMerge
= 82;
84 const long msoShapeFlowchartMultidocument
= 68;
85 const long msoShapeFlowchartOffpageConnector
= 74;
86 const long msoShapeFlowchartOr
= 78;
87 const long msoShapeFlowchartPredefinedProcess
= 65;
88 const long msoShapeFlowchartPreparation
= 70;
89 const long msoShapeFlowchartProcess
= 61;
90 const long msoShapeFlowchartPunchedTape
= 76;
91 const long msoShapeFlowchartSequentialAccessStorage
= 85;
92 const long msoShapeFlowchartSort
= 80;
93 const long msoShapeFlowchartStoredData
= 83;
94 const long msoShapeFlowchartSummingJunction
= 77;
95 const long msoShapeFlowchartTerminator
= 69;
96 const long msoShapeFoldedCorner
= 16;
97 const long msoShapeHeart
= 21;
98 const long msoShapeHexagon
= 10;
99 const long msoShapeHorizontalScroll
= 102;
100 const long msoShapeIsoscelesTriangle
= 7;
101 const long msoShapeLeftArrow
= 34;
102 const long msoShapeLeftArrowCallout
= 54;
103 const long msoShapeLeftBrace
= 31;
104 const long msoShapeLeftBracket
= 29;
105 const long msoShapeLeftRightArrow
= 37;
106 const long msoShapeLeftRightArrowCallout
= 57;
107 const long msoShapeLeftRightUpArrow
= 40;
108 const long msoShapeLeftUpArrow
= 43;
109 const long msoShapeLightningBolt
= 22;
110 const long msoShapeLineCallout1
= 109;
111 const long msoShapeLineCallout1AccentBar
= 113;
112 const long msoShapeLineCallout1BorderandAccentBar
= 121;
113 const long msoShapeLineCallout1NoBorder
= 117;
114 const long msoShapeLineCallout2
= 110;
115 const long msoShapeLineCallout2AccentBar
= 114;
116 const long msoShapeLineCallout2BorderandAccentBar
= 122;
117 const long msoShapeLineCallout2NoBorder
= 118;
118 const long msoShapeLineCallout3
= 111;
119 const long msoShapeLineCallout3AccentBar
= 115;
120 const long msoShapeLineCallout3BorderandAccentBar
= 123;
121 const long msoShapeLineCallout3NoBorder
= 119;
122 const long msoShapeLineCallout4
= 112;
123 const long msoShapeLineCallout4AccentBar
= 116;
124 const long msoShapeLineCallout4BorderandAccentBar
= 124;
125 const long msoShapeLineCallout4NoBorder
= 120;
126 const long msoShapeMixed
= -2;
127 const long msoShapeMoon
= 24;
128 const long msoShapeNoSymbol
= 19;
129 const long msoShapeNotchedRightArrow
= 50;
130 const long msoShapeNotPrimitive
= 138;
131 const long msoShapeOctagon
= 6;
132 const long msoShapeOval
= 9;
133 const long msoShapeOvalCallout
= 107;
134 const long msoShapeParallelogram
= 2;
135 const long msoShapePentagon
= 51;
136 const long msoShapePlaque
= 28;
137 const long msoShapeQuadArrow
= 39;
138 const long msoShapeQuadArrowCallout
= 59;
139 const long msoShapeRectangle
= 1;
140 const long msoShapeRectangularCallout
= 105;
141 const long msoShapeRegularPentagon
= 12;
142 const long msoShapeRightArrow
= 33;
143 const long msoShapeRightArrowCallout
= 53;
144 const long msoShapeRightBrace
= 32;
145 const long msoShapeRightBracket
= 30;
146 const long msoShapeRightTriangle
= 8;
147 const long msoShapeRoundedRectangle
= 5;
148 const long msoShapeRoundedRectangularCallout
= 106;
149 const long msoShapeSmileyFace
= 17;
150 const long msoShapeStripedRightArrow
= 49;
151 const long msoShapeSun
= 23;
152 const long msoShapeTrapezoid
= 3;
153 const long msoShapeUpArrow
= 35;
154 const long msoShapeUpArrowCallout
= 55;
155 const long msoShapeUpDownArrow
= 38;
156 const long msoShapeUpDownArrowCallout
= 58;
157 const long msoShapeUpRibbon
= 97;
158 const long msoShapeUTurnArrow
= 42;
159 const long msoShapeVerticalScroll
= 101;
160 const long msoShapeWave
= 103;
164 /* vim:set shiftwidth=4 softtabstop=4 expandtab: */